I did some research on her magic system; you're not the first person to make the comparison. I wasn't aware of her books when I designed the system, and while there are surface-level similarities, there are also major differences.

Both systems assign a small subset of effects to each colour, but I hate to toot my own horn, but mine is quite a bit deeper and more complex (maybe the complexity is a bad thing lol :D)

If you liked the visual elements and descriptive ability of her magic, then you'd likely enjoy this system as well, but for hers, where the colour was the fuel, in this system, the emotion someone feels is the fuel, and the colour is just an indicator. In mine, the effect is mapped to the emotion love heals, hate breaks, shame hides, and curiosity finds. It just so happens that each of those has a hue associated with it and that the colour wheel makes sense thematically. Amber is pure emotional desire/attraction; it sits between red/love and yellow/joy. Purple or amethyst is passionate desire (lust and intimacy), it sits between physical desire/indigo and red/love.

I wasn't arbitrary in assigning shades to each emotion.

Where mine is deeper is that each colour maps to a spectrum of emotions Red = love and hate, but love can be uplifting and generous or manipulative, anger can be righteous and protective as well as self-destructive, and the effects can range from healing/repairing to degrading/destroying/rusting
